At a press conference on September 12, 2023, Arts et Métiers its intention to train more engineers. How? By developing partnerships, increasing the range of courses on offer, opening new campuses, and more.
" Every year in France, 50,000 engineers are trained, but the need will be 100,000 by 2027. Our goal is to increase the number of Arts et Métiers graduates by 50% Arts et Métiers 2027 ," said Laurent Champaney, CEOArts et Métiers a press conference on September 12, 2023. Accompanied by Nadège Troussier,Deputy CEO for Training, and Coline Moal Vignon, Director of AMTalents, he presented the institution's major projects.

Other collaborative projects are being carried out in support of theArts et Métiers sectors.
- The CaMeX-IA project, one of nine Campus des Métiers et des Qualifications (Vocational Training and Qualifications Campuses) in the Grand Est region, provides training in the use of artificial intelligence and digital technology for professions in industry, building, and construction.
- The CAIRE Project, " Citizen-oriented Artificial Intelligence training for a Responsible Education," led byHESAM University, aims to establish a sustainable approach to training students to serve organizations and regions by extensively integrating acculturation and mastery of artificial intelligence techniques and technologies.
Developing lifelong learning support with the AMTalents subsidiary
- The establishment of a partnership with DSTI (Data ScienceTech Institute) to address the challenges of the digital industry (Industry 4.0) in order to offer a degree to engineers and support to companies facing the challenges of digitalization in industry: "Digital Industry and AI"
- A partnership withESSCA, a leading business school, to launch an Experiential Online MBA, the " MBA BUSINESS & TECHNOLOGY" , in September 2024. This program combines online courses with experiential face-to-face modules, such as immersion in the Arts et Métiers innovation laboratory Arts et Métiers an American campus of technological excellence.
- The 14 Arts et Métiers Specialized Master's degreesoffer highly specialized training in a specific role, profession, or rapidly growing sector, with approximately 160 to 200 students enrolled each year.
